Description

This program calculates the times of sunrise and sunset in terms of UTC (=Universal Time Coordinated). Times are displayed e.g. as "17.32 h.m" = 17 hours and 32 minutes. UTC corresponds to winter-time in London. For time-zone Berlin add 1 hour, add 2 hours in summer. For New York subtract 5 hours, in summer 4 hours. The precision of the times for sunrise and sunset is about 1 minute, for duration of dawn 5 min. At positions beyond 60 degrees latitude precision of dawn decreases. Longitude is positive for East, negative for West. Latitude is positive for North, negative for South.

Results were checked against Nautisches Jahrbuch 2020 by Bundesamt für Seeschifffahrt und Hydrographie and against the NOAA Solar Calculator https://gml.noaa.gov/grad/solcalc/. An explicit program can be found at https://gist.github.com/Alex1Git/8616956 where reference is made to Roland Brodbeck. The formulas have been checked with https://www.astronomie.info/zeitgleichung/neu.html. See also the book Astronomical Algorithms by Jean Meeus.
